China remains a serious challenge
By Paul Lin 林保華
Taipei Times 2024.4.26
With tensions between China and the Philippines heating up, face-offs have not only occurred in the South China Sea, but the Philippines also skipped the Western Pacific Naval Symposium — which received delegations from 29 countries, including the US — hosted by China.
Lately, many Chinese exchange students have flocked to Cagayan province in the northern Philippine island of Luzon, leading to a surging enrollment in private universities in Tuguegarao City.
